2010-05-11 41 views
1

我想构建一个由三个页面组成的网站,但使用ASP.NET的联系表单。现在我已经构建了布局和所有的xhtml/css和一些javascript,然后我将它转换为动态的并且可以发送电子邮件。XHTML/CSS布局到ASP.NET

我是否需要使用Visual Studio进行转换,或者将文件从.html重命名为.aspx?然后在Visual Studio中的一个形式?... 困惑:(

回答

1

我建议以下步骤:

  1. 如果您还没有这样做,开始与一些ASP .NET教程,创建一个项目并构建一个包含代码的简单页面,以便了解ASP.NET如何工作。

  2. 一旦您熟悉ASP.NET,请创建一个新项目。将您的联系表单重命名为aspx并将其添加到Visual Studio项目中。

  3. 编写代码(提示:查看发送邮件的文档MailMessage class)。

+0

我有ASP.NET的一些非常基本的概念,但我想知道清楚我的概念是什么设计和编程ASP.NET的工作流程。你是否使用Visual Studio来创建所有设计,或只是为了逻辑或编程代码? – 2010-05-11 10:02:51

+0

个人而言,我不仅使用Visual Studio进行开发,而且还使用Visual Studio进行网页设计(主要使用HTML源代码编辑器)。但是,这不是要求。其他人使用Expression Web或某些第三方软件进行设计。 – Heinzi 2010-05-11 11:25:53

0

首先,ASP.NET是一个服务器端的技术,什么是呈现在浏览器上仍然是老一套纯HTML/XHTML加上CSS和Javascript(或者它的变体,比如jQuery),所以没有什么区别,看看生成的(X)HTML,你可以确定你需要做些什么改变,为了简单起见,你可以修改你的CSS。

0

你可以做的是:

  1. 创建一个新的ASP.NET Web项目
  2. 将现有的HTML文件添加到该项目中。
  3. 添加联系人发送邮件等的ASP页面如果需要。
  4. 然后,您可以使用iframe
显示HTML页面内的ASPX页面